党参超微饮片对小鼠抗疲劳和耐缺氧作用的研究  被引量:14

摘  要:目的:观察党参超微饮片的抗疲劳作用和耐缺氧作用.方法:50只小鼠随机分成空白对照组、党参超微饮片低、中、高剂量组、人参饮片组共5组,分别灌胃给药10 mL/Kg,1次/d,连续7 d,观察药物的抗疲劳作用及在常压缺氧状态下小鼠的平均存活时间.结果:不同剂量党参超微饮片能明显延长小鼠的游泳时间和小鼠在缺氧状态下的存活时间,与空白对照组相比,差异有统计学意义(P<0.05,P<0.01).结论:党参超微饮片具有显著的抗疲劳和耐缺氧作用.Objective: To observe the Codonopsis Ultramicro the role of anti-fatigue effects and hypoxia. Methods: 50 mice were randomly divided into control group, Codonopsis Ultramicro low, medium and high dose group, ginseng slices Group 5 groups were administered orally 10 mL/Kg, 1 times/d, 7 d continuous to observe the anti-fatigue effects of drugs and oxygen at atmospheric pressure and under the average survival time. Results: Different doses of Codonopsis Ultramicro could signifi- cantly prolong the swimming time of mice and mice survival time under hypoxic conditions, compared with the control group, the difference was statistically significant (P〈0.05, P〈0.01) . Conclusion: Codonopsis Ultramicro has significant anti-fatigue and hypoxia tolerance.
